Skinboost (now with clinics at York and Cottingham) can help you look after your skin in a way that you feel good about, whilst maintaining your natural appearance.
Skinboost understand the importance of treatments being carried out in a professional and safe way and that your practitioner is trained in all aspects of your treatment, and they are therefore proud to have been awarded the quality mark ???Treatments You Can Trust’ which is backed by the Department of Health.
It is a Quality mark for which have everything in place for your safety, for example training infection control and high quality treatments. This is a register which allows customers to be sure they are choosing a clinic which has been for safety to protect the public.
Caroline Tripp (owner of Skinboost) is a Qualified Nurse with over 25 years experience within the NHS where she has worked as a senior nurse within surgery and critical care, and 5 years within Aesthetics.
Her philosophy is to prevent premature aging and provide optimum results by using injectables and providing evidence based skincare.
She is an Independent Nurse Prescriber and so can prescribe and skincare at a strength which will give long term results.
Caroline has had extensive experience within aesthetics and delivers advanced cutting edge procedures such as 'the liquid face lift ' and facial re sculpting, she has now become a national trainer, within this field where she is an advisor injector and trainer to doctors dentists and nurses.
is an active member of the BACN (British Association of Cosmetic Nurses) and regularly attends conferences to keep updated with new advances within this area.
Feel assured that your treatment is in safe hands as Caroline is fully insured with Hamilton Fraser insurance and RCN (Royal College of Nursing)

toxin type A, know by the brand names Botox (Vistabel), Dysport (Azzalure) and Xeomin (Bocouture), is a naturally occurring protein produced by the bacterium clostridium botulinum. It is licensed as a prescription only medicine and can be used to treat wrinkles like frown lines and crow`s feet as well as hyperhidrosis or excessive sweating. As a prescription only medicine, it requires a face-to-face consultation to determine your suitability for treatment.
The use of chemical peels to soften and improve the appearance of skin dates back to the ancient Egyptians. Today, scientists have identified numerous forms of acid which can be used to treat skin.
Cryolipolysis is a non-invasive fat removal procedure. It involves the of subcutaneous fat cells, which induces lipolysis, the breaking down of the fat cells, without damaging any of the surrounding tissues or the skin.
Dermabrasion is a surgical procedure which aims to "resurface" the skin. It uses a to remove the outer layer of the skin or epidermis and then the top third part of the dermis of the skin.

Unlike dermal fillers which are aimed at mechanically filling wrinkles, folds and skin depressions, tissue stimulators are injectable products which cause a biological reaction in the tissue.
The use of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s), red, yellow and blue light sources for the treatment of acne and for skin rejuvenation.
Skin Needling, also referred to as Collagen Induction Therapy and Micro-Needling is aimed at the body’s own collagen production to re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.
Mesotherapy is a medical technique used for the treatment of cosmetic conditions, including skin rejuvenation and improvement, hair regrowth, localised fat reduction and as a treatment for cellulite.
Microdermabrasion helps improve the texture and appearance of the skin using a stream of fine micro particles which partially removes the outermost layer of the skin and stimulates new cell growth.

Sclerotherapy was developed for treating varicose veins. Microsclerotherapy is a technique of injecting thread veins with a sclerosant that causes swelling in the vein’s wall which destroys it.

ThermaVein™ uses Veinwave™ technology which is already proven within the medical field for the process known as thermocoagulation which seals the walls of thread veins with a micro-current of heat, causing them to permanently disappear. It can also be used to treat other skin lesions.

Commonly concerns are focussed on changes in the skin and ones complexion that occur as we age. Skin specialists now believe that most of the changes that we see in our skin as we grow older are due to the sun (sometimes referred to as "photodamage").
The concept of facial skin tightening refers to procedures which seek to cause contraction in the tissues to effectively tighten them up or which involve a lifting technique often accompanied by the removal of excess skin.
A variety of treatments and lifestyle changes can be recommended to relieve menopausal symptoms, some of which are available through the NHS and others through the private healthcare system.
The signs of ageing on a person’s face start to show as early as the end of the second or the beginning of the third decade of a persons life. At first, fine lines start to form between the nose and the mouth, around the eyes and on the forehead.
Lip augmentation, volumising, shaping or enhancement is a cosmetic procedure which uses various materials to plump out and re-shape the lips.
The male menopause, or andropause, is a real thing. A variety of treatments, including Replacement Therapies for men and lifestyle can be recommended to relieve symptoms.
Moles, warts, skin tags can be both upsetting to look at and cause social and psychological unease. Thankfully though, most growths are benign and harmless, and removal is often quick and simple with reassuring cosmetic results.
Age spots or lentigos, sometimes known as "liver spots" are medically known under the condition of hyperpigmentation. Professional skincare clinics have effective treatments to reduce the appearance of more pronounced age spots or hyperpigmentation.
is a common chronic skin condition that tends to affect the face. Individuals with vascular rosacea, which tends to include symptoms such as flushing, redness and thread veins, can often be successfully treated with laser or IPL treatment.
Scarring can affect a person’s confidence and self-esteem, when the scars are on the face. Depending on the type of scar and the way an individual heals there are a variety of options for improving the appearance of scarring.
A variety of options, including using heat generating technologies such as light and electrical currents have been developed to treat thread veins, also called spider or broken veins.
